The Indus Valley Civilization was one of the world ’s first great urban civilizations‚ existing from 3000 B.C.E to 1500 B.C.E. During their time they have contributed much to the history of the world through their influences on culture‚ religion‚ government‚ social structure‚ economy and technology. The Indus Valley Civilization was located along the river valleys of the Indus‚ Ravi‚ and Sutlej. archaeology. When Schliemann and newest wife Sophie arrived in Greece‚ the Turkish government hadn’t yet granted them permission to dig. Schliemann left Sophie in Greece and illegally began digging two trenches at Hissarlik. There he uncovered coins‚ pottery‚ and other artifacts‚ as well as the remains of a wall and evidence that the city was razed and rebuilt several times.
